CNP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2018 in Review

621 of the 4,488 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in CenterPoint Energy (CNP) for Q4 2018, worth a combined $11.4B — up 3.1% from $11.1B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 96 funds opened new CNP positions and 81 closed out — a net gain of 15 holders — while 232 added to existing stakes and 208 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Fidelity Investments, adding an estimated $96.4M. The largest seller was Balyasny Asset Management, cutting an estimated $133M.
